A facile and sensitive colorimetric detection for RNase A activity based on target regulated protection effect on plasmonic gold nanoparticles aggregation
Wang, R (Wang, Rui); Yu, RZ (Yu, Renzhong); Wang, ZY (Wang, Zhaoyin); Zhu, QS (Zhu, Qinshu)[ 1 ]*; Dai, ZH (Dai, Zhihui)[ 1 ]*(戴志晖)

 

[ 1 ] Nanjing Normal Univ, Sch Chem & Mat Sci, Jiangsu Collaborat Innovat Ctr Biomed Funct Mat, Nanjing 210023, Peoples R China
[ 2 ] Nanjing Normal Univ, Sch Chem & Mat Sci, Jiangsu Key Lab Biofunct Mat, Nanjing 210023, Peoples R China

SCIENCE CHINA-CHEMISTRY,202003,10.1007/s11426-020-9702-1

 

In this work, a facile and sensitive colorimetric detection method was firstly reported for RNase A activity detection based on target regulated protection effect of chimeric DNA probe on the salt-induced aggregation of plasmonic gold nanoparticles. Compared with previous works of RNase A activity detection, this colorimetric assay integrated the advantages of sensitive, low cost, facile operation, rapid response and low biological toxicity.
